Output 3357c1f2ea9049268c43b251c91906914b0609e5614fe3aab001340f8090266a:1

value
506749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004babd1552f2173c55d57c0e9d634fe86ca8324 OP_EQUAL
address
31iaaGWuWkJzP2GjDVBXiHgXX7wPZ6AkeD
transaction
3357c1f2ea9049268c43b251c91906914b0609e5614fe3aab001340f8090266a
spent
true